As consumer trends rise toward buying products that are healthy, natural and compassionate to the environment, some retailers are making it simple to shop for eco-friendly gifts for the holidays.

The Soap Kitchen and Patagonia Clothing in Old Pasadena, CA have joined together to help shoppers gain a healthier perspective for this holiday’s gift giving season. In an effort to promote an eco-friendly stress-free shopping experience, they will be hosting a special event on Monday, Dec. 11th from 6-8pm, offering expert advice from personal shoppers, complimentary refreshments and activities for the kids, free gift bags, free shipping, free gift wrapping, and parking validation.

The Soap kitchen is dedicated to preserving the earth, the animals, and the environment by offering products that are all natural and free of artificial colors, fragrances or preservatives commonly found in commercial soaps. “Not only are our products eco-friendly, but they are better for your body,” proudly boasts storeowner Dali Yu. It’s no wonder that this retailer found a compassionate friend and neighbor, Patagonia, whose commitment to product quality and environmental activism is highly acclaimed among the eco-friendly community and consumers alike. They offer a wide range of men’s, women’s and kid’s eco-friendly clothing and gear for those living a healthy, active, and green lifestyle.
